The invention relates to an arrangement for producing pigmented mixtures. The mixtures contemplated by the invention may be: plasters, paints and similar mixtures, especially those used in the construction and construction industries. Such mixtures, in particular plasters, are colored by adding and mixing pigment in a so-called "Tinting Station". The activity of coloring mixtures is associated with the very strenuous physical work of the workers involved in this work. Namely, the 25 kg to 30 kg containers from pallets have to be lifted away into the station for the addition of the pigment (Tinting Station). Then the containers must be placed in a mixer and finally sized on a pallet. The pigment added to a mixture according to the invention is principally an inorganic, in exceptional cases an organic, pigment which gives the mixture, for example the plaster, the desired color. As in the invention, a, for example, automatic, conveyor track and, for example, within the same, a device for handling, such as putting on and removing, contains of batch containing containers, the hitherto carried out by workers lifting work from the device for Handle containers containing mixtures. The device for handling, such as placing and removing, containers is, for example, a robot, for example a multi-axis articulated-arm industrial robot, which is movable according to several degrees of freedom. If a container containing a mixture to be mixed with pigment has passed through the stations of the arrangement according to the invention, the mixture is mixed with the desired amount of pigment, mixed, marked accordingly and the container stands as finished container for removal, for example, on a pallet , ready. In the context of the invention can be provided that the pitches for batch containing containers and finished packages are designed as pitches for pallets. The device for identifying containers provided in the context of the invention can be designed as a station for labeling by means of a code, in particular a bar code. In particular, the device for identifying containers can be assigned a device for opening the containers, in particular for removing container lids. For example, it is provided that the device for handling (putting on and removing) of packages containing containers also carries out the opening of containers, for which purpose it is provided for example with a hook, which acts on a grip tab of container lids. The device provided for mixing in the arrangement according to the invention can be designed as a stirrer. Alternatively, the means for mixing may be formed as a gyroscopic shaker. In one embodiment of the arrangement according to the invention, the conveyor track is assigned a station for quality control. In order to allow an orderly storage of finished containers, the conveyor belt in front of the parking space for finished containers a device for reading attached to the containers and the content of the container characterizing data carriers, such as bar codes, be assigned. In a preferred embodiment, the conveyor track of the arrangement according to the invention is a circular, semi-circular or U-shaped conveyor track, wherein it is preferred that the conveyor track is designed as a roller conveyor. The arrangement 1 shown in Fig. 1 comprises a part-circular, in the example substantially semicircular, roller conveyor as a conveyor track 2 for containing pigment to be offset mixture containing container. Within the conveyor track 2, a robot 4 is provided as a device 3 for handling, namely for placing and removing, containing mixtures containing rotatable at least about a vertical axis and preferably designed as articulated arm robot with multiple degrees of freedom. The robot 4 can also be used to supply stations and areas of the arrangement 1 container and remove again. The conveyor track 2 of the arrangement 1 according to the invention is at least one pallet space 5 for the task of containers ("fresh task"), the content (mixture) is to be provided with at least one pigment, allocated in the pallets can be parked. Following the pallet location 5, a feed area 6 is provided on the conveyor track 2, as seen in a clockwise direction. In the task area 6, the bar code of the label of the container is read and also the labeling of the container with other bar codes (color number, batch number) made. Furthermore, the containers, in particular the lower parts (containers) of the same, are fixed in the task area 6, in order to allow the opening of the containers by removing the container lid with the aid of the robot 4. For this purpose, the robot 4 may be equipped with a hook which engages in a grip tab of the container lid when a container is opened by lifting the container lid. After the application area 6, a station 7 for adding pigment (inking station) is provided in which the mixture contained in the container is added with the at least one selected pigment in the respectively required amount. Following the station 7, a mixing device 8 is provided, which in the exemplary embodiment of FIG. 1 is designed as a mixing device 8 with automatic cleaning of the mixing tools (stirring tools). Following the first mixing station 8, a second mixing station 8, likewise with automatic cleaning of the mixing tools (stirring tools), is provided in the exemplary embodiment of FIG. 1. After the second mixing station 8 a station 9 is provided for quality control. Subsequent to the station 9 for quality control, a device 10 is provided, are closed with the container again, including cover, for example, from a lid magazine, placed on lower parts (tub) of the container and pressed. After closing the container, a removal area 11 is provided for finished goods, which is associated with a bar code reader. Following the acceptance area 11 two parking spaces 12 are provided for finished goods (finished goods) in the form of pallet spaces. By way of example, the arrangement shown in FIG. 1 can be used as follows: An employee places, for example by means of a forklift, pallets 21 with containers 22 containing the mixture to be provided with pigment on one of the plots 5. The robot 4 recognizes the packing pattern on the pallet 21 and lifts it Container 22 successively on the conveyor track 2. In the task area 6, the bar code of the container 22 is read in and thus the mixture contained in the container 22 detected. Furthermore, an additional bar code with color number and article number is attached to the container 22 in the application area 6. Following this, the container 22 is moved by the roller conveyor from the feed area 6 to the station 7 for adding pigment (inking station). The station 7 is given the order to color the mixture contained in the container 22 according to the order by adding pigment. The conveyor track 2 conveys the container 22 further to the mixing station 8, whereby depending on the order number one or the other of the mixing stations 8 is used. For quality control by an employee, the conveyor 2 stops the first and last batches 22 of a batch in the quality control station 9. In this case, a reset sample can be pulled and for the container 22, for example, by an automatic roller conveyor or by the robot 4, are moved to a waiting position. After sampling, the container 22 by an automatic roller conveyor or the robot 4, abandoned on the conveyor track 2. Following this, in the device 10 for closing the container 22, the container lid is placed from a lid magazine 23 onto the container 22 and fixed, so that the container 22 is closed again. In the acceptance area 11 is detected by means of a bar code reader to which container 22 it is and which of the two pallets 21 in the pallet slots 12 for Ready-made containers are ready, containers 22 are provided. The robot 4 places the container 22 on the selected pallet 21 and a forklift removes the finished pallet 21 loaded with containers 22 (finished container) from the pallet position 12 and conveys it for wrapping.
